About us

Pomelo Care is a multi-disciplinary team of clinicians, engineers and problem solvers who are passionate about improving care for moms and babies. We are transforming outcomes for pregnant people and babies with evidence-based pregnancy and newborn care at scale. Our technology-driven care platform enables us to engage patients early, conduct individualized risk assessments for poor pregnancy outcomes, and deliver coordinated, personalized virtual care throughout pregnancy, NICU stays, and the first postpartum year. We measure ourselves by reductions in preterm births, NICU admissions, c-sections and maternal mortality; we improve outcomes and reduce healthcare spend.

Role Description

Your North Star: Work with the New Ventures team to complete health plan credentialing accurately & efficiently.

What You’ll Do

  • Complete group & practitioner health plan credentialing on behalf of Pomelo’s telehealth clinic & care team.
  • Track applications from submission to approval, contracting, and agreement, ensuring cross-functional visibility into key milestones & timelines.
  • Proactively mitigate application delays & denials; Rigorously follow up on any delays and/or denials to right-size

  • Collaborate with Pomelo licensing, credentialing, and enrollment team to ensure proper clinician licensure & up-to-date CAQH profiles, to help expedite health plan credentialing
  • Collaborates with care team of nurses, nurse practitioners, doctors, therapists & registered dietitians to support navigation & answer questions about clinician credentialing applications

Who You Are

  • 2-4 years of experience in a high volume, credentialing specialist role
  • Deep expertise with commercial health plan credentialing processes, including health plan portals & CAQH
  • Highly organized with a strong attention to detail.
  • A proactive and resourceful problem-solver who is comfortable navigating ambiguity and independently seeks out answers and solutions. 
  • An accountable and collaborative team player with excellent communication skills, both written and verbal.
  • An expert at prioritization & time management, who proactively shares deliverable timelines and roadblocks

Potential Fraud Warning


Please be cautious of potential recruitment fraud. With the increase of remote work and digital hiring, phishing and job scams are on the rise with malicious actors impersonating real employees and sending fake job offers in an effort to collect personal or financial information.

Pomelo Care will never ask you to pay a fee or download software as part of the interview process with our company. Pomelo Care will also never ask for your personal banking or other financial information until after you have signed an offer of employment and completed onboarding paperwork that is provided by our People Operations team. All official communication with Pomelo Care People Operations team will come from domain email addresses ending in @pomelocare.com.

If you receive a message that seems suspicious, we encourage you to pause communication and contact us directly at careers@pomelocare.com  to confirm its legitimacy. For your safety, we also recommend applying only through our official Careers page. If you believe you have been the victim of a scam or identity theft, please contact your local law enforcement agency or another trusted authority for guidance.
